Soares wants to stay

November 15 2005

Tom Soares

Tom Soares

Tom Soares has vowed to stay at Crystal Palace despite being reportedly linked with Liverpool.

The 19-year-old has formed an impressive partnership alongside fellow youth product Ben Watson in centre midfield.

And after just missing out on October's Championship player-of-the-month award, Soares is happy with life at Palace.

"I'm happy here," said Soares. "I'm playing and everything's good. The boys are good and there are good facilities here. I'm happy where I am. I am going to stay and I'm glad they feel that they actually want me to stay.

"I'm playing central midfield and I prefer it there. I feel I bring more to the team from there. I just have to keep playing, improving and stay there.

"Ben and I have played together for a while, with the youth team and so on. We have a good understanding and work well with each other."
